Geocache Description:

Happy 10th Geocachers!


3pm at the Sexton's Cottage.

An informal gathering for everyone to come along swap stories, trade travel bugs, put faces to caching names, and catch up with old friends and new.


This is Dunedin's 10th anniversary gathering, and will be held in the Sexton's Cottage at the gates of the Dunedin North Cemetery.


Why there? Well, it's the closest available facility to one of Dunedin's cluster of venerable caches, GCB2. For those of you who haven't found that one there will be plenty of time before or after the event!


This is primarily a catchup and chat, with a few spot or achievement prizes tossed in for good measure every so often, but no seriously organised activities at this stage.

Tea & Coffee will be provided, and feel free to bring a plate, but there is no obligation to.


And a salute to:

GCAF Mt Cargill (11 Nov 2000)

GCB0 Flagstaff (11 Nov 2000)

GCB1 Unity Park (12 Nov 2000)

GCB2 Botanical Gardens (12 Nov 2000)


Oh, and yes technically this is 10 years since Selective Availability being turned off rather than the first cache placement: The Original Stash (03 May 2000)



Remember: to make this a special '10 Year' event, we need to meet the following:
  • At least 10 people must attend the event.
  • A video or picture must be taken at the event. At least 10 attendees must be in the video/photo along with a legible sign showing the event coordinates and location name.
  • The people in the video or photo should be festive. (Think Party or Silly Hats!) Be inventive! But please keep it family friendly.
